**Lifestyle Modifications: A Crucial Component**
Lifestyle modifications play a vital role in hypertension management. Patients should adopt a healthy diet, r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ains, and low in sodium and saturated fats. Regular physical activity, weight management, and stress reduction techniques are also essential. Smoking cessation is a critical step for anyone with hypertension.
**Access to Specialists: Cardiology, Nephrology, and Endocrinology**
Hypertension can affect multiple organ systems, so access to specialists is crucial. Cardiologists are essential for managing cardiovascular complications, while nephrologists focus on kidney health, and endocrinologists address hormonal imbalances that can contribute to hypertension.
